Gryzlov appointed new ambassador of Russia to Belarus

16:09, 14 January

Russian President Vladimir Putin has appointed Boris Gryzlov as the new Russian ambassador to Belarus. The corresponding decree of the head of state was published on the official portal of legal information on 14 January, BelTA has learned.

"To appoint Boris Gryzlov as Ambassador Extraordinary and Plenipotentiary of the Russian Federation to the Republic of Belarus," the document says.
